Getting the Best Bang for Your Buck with Spoon-Feeding Nitrogen

Nitrogen is one of the most crucial, and pricey, inputs no-tillers must manage each year, with a penchant for inefficiency — with as much as 40% of N failing to go into the crop in some cases. But Mike Starkey is using technology to increase N-use efficiency to boost yields and reduce waste. The Brownsburg, Ind., no-tiller will share tips and data from his multi-faceted approach that center around spoon feeding of N according to the plant’s needs, including at-plant N application, sidedressing, stabilizers, aerial photography and variable-rate application, along with appropriate cover crop management.
